Output dd6da4794680a6a61007bd9a0b818d00a4340819a3f3dfd9f9e8d22995d404e5:1

value
644249
script pubkey
OP_0 OP_PUSHBYTES_20 305f2508d07026aca32b71ac006d18fa2893dc10
address
bc1qxp0j2zxswqn2egetwxkqqmgclg5f8hqsyrj689
transaction
dd6da4794680a6a61007bd9a0b818d00a4340819a3f3dfd9f9e8d22995d404e5
confirmations
37778
spent
true